The Renault 5 Turbo belongs to that wonderful category of absurdly radical cars born because of competition. What began as a small French city car ended up as a widened rally machine, with a mid-mounted engine and an almost cartoonish look.
The little hatchback that decided to fight the Lancia Stratos
That is a big part of its charm: it still carries something recognisable from the regular Renault 5, but everything feels exaggerated. Wider, lower and far more aggressive than anyone would expect from such a small car.
